What part of the nervous system controls your internal organs?
Gnom [1K]
<span>The autonomic nervous system is the part of the nervous system that controls muscles of internal organs (such as the heart, blood vessels, lungs, stomach, and intestines) and glands (such as salivary glands and sweat glands</span>
